Built approx. 5 years ago, this impressive town house offers stylish and contemporary living in this central position. The beautifully presented accommodation includes a reception hall, downstairs cloakroom, and a lovely open plan living/dining & kitchen area with a range of integrated appliances and fully retractable bi-folding doors opening out to the garden. Upstairs, there are 3 bedrooms and 2 luxury bath/shower rooms, bedroom 3 is currently used as a home office. Outside, there is a single garage with electric roller door, and an enclosed town garden at the rear. The property further benefits from underfloor heating (ground floor), solar panels, residents permit parking, and a New Home Build Guarantee (expiring in 2030).

A convenient location close to Pittville Park, the Brewery Quarter, and the town centre. Cheltenham is a vibrant Regency town, best known for its beautiful architecture, excellent shopping, and horse racing at the world famous Prestbury Park Racecourse. Cheltenham also plays host to the music, jazz, science, and literature festivals currently held in Imperial Gardens.
